OK Italy...a couple questions

A few questions for Italy:
How is it that Italians rate an A+ for Crazy Drivers and the USA lags way back with only an B+...I mean didn’t we invent road-rage?
Why are cars in Italy cuter than anywhere else...they actually look like they are smiling at you.
Why are there no cows in Italy...no kidding! We’ve been on the move since we got here and I’ve only seen 12 cows total...with this many miles behind us in the US, we would have seen at least 25,000... Where’s the Beef!
Why does nobody play golf in Italy...again, since I’ve been here I haven’t seen 1 golf course...none on the highways, none around the resorts, yes None. But we have seen lots of bikers...thats cyclist, mopeds and Italy’s version of crouch rockets. These guys are everywhere and sneak up on you in an instant...they also apparently do not have to follow any laws or rules.
Why are there no building codes in Italy...we stayed in a place, that had an average ceiling height of about 5’ 4”, a doorway that was about 4’6” and a staircase that went up 7 or 8 feet within 6 feet, we are talking straight up, if you used the oven you couldn’t wash the clothes because you’d trip the breaker, in fact we did trip the breaker a number of times and have zero idea why, the bathroom shower was intended for someone about 4’4” and you had to be a contortionist to bath, and the water had to run for 5 minutes before you could get hot water to use...our second place has to big things going for it, a shower that you can stand up in and a queen size bed that is wonderful. The only real problem here is we now have a stairway that goes up 8‘ within a 5‘ span, these are “billy goat” stairs.
Why do all the restaurants have exactly the same menu...variation in price, and maybe cooking procedures, but yes, they all have the same regional dishes. My friend Alessio told me the Italians were very provincial people...and I see it everyday. Sure the food is awesome but the same menu!! Come on! OK, OK . I know, I know....still the 2 best foods in the world are...1) Pesto (from Italy), and 2) Gelato (any kind).
Why are some Worker Strikes pre announced and very civilized, while others just kind of happen...the train workers are the worse (or best depending on your view).
How come Italians have more to talk about than anyone else in the world. These quiet little towns are full of people who have more to say than anyone you’ve ever meant. You see them sitting together, what seems like all day, and never a quiet moment. And I swear the hand waving has to be some kind of workout routine they’ve all learned.
And most important...Where have you Italians hidden all the Peanut Butter...I have looked in every single store I’ve been in??? Please if you know, tell me!
On a serious note...The beauty of Italy is worth every dollar, pound, euro or yen you spend to come here. It’s magnifico.
